Output 73c83f145a233f937f5218a10fa89a0fe13d93f68b218e9aba36b3f0f4d682a5:1

value
979848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ee9c1138e54b87cfa9c8b197975324884dda4da3 OP_EQUAL
address
3PSfhwgwPR61dPb5wpaeZ4YH7EyQm97VtB
transaction
73c83f145a233f937f5218a10fa89a0fe13d93f68b218e9aba36b3f0f4d682a5
spent
true